"The Greatest Battles in History" offers a captivating journey through 25 pivotal military engagements that have shaped the course of human civilization. From the ancient clash at Marathon, where Greek hoplites defied the Persian Empire, to the modern inferno of Stalingrad, the book explores the strategic, tactical, and human dimensions of warfare. Readers will witness the brilliance of commanders like Alexander the Great, Hannibal, and Scipio Africanus, alongside the tragic consequences of leadership failures. This book features famous battles such as Thermopylae, Cannae, Alesia, Actium, Hastings, Agincourt, Saratoga, and Waterloo.
The book delves into the details of each battle, examining not only the military maneuvers and technological innovations but also the motivations and experiences of the soldiers on the front lines. The narratives highlight how these conflicts redrew maps, toppled empires, and influenced the development of societies and cultures. The long-term historical impacts of each engagement are also considered, demonstrating how battles such as Yarmouk, Tours, Ain Jalut, and Lepanto affected the rise and fall of civilizations, and the spread of religions and cultures.
Beyond a mere recounting of events, "The Greatest Battles in History" provides a window into the human condition, revealing both extraordinary courage and profound suffering. It underscores the enduring impact of conflict on the world, exploring the evolution of warfare and its profound consequences. The book's broad chronological and geographical scope, spanning from ancient Greece to World War II, and from Europe to the Middle East and the Pacific, provides a comprehensive overview of military history's most defining moments.
